For global buyers comparing 3.5-inch PVC vertical blinds, one measurement deserves careful attention. An 88.9 mm slat equals 3.5 inches, not 5 inches. A true 5-inch slat measures about 127 mm. This difference affects the blind’s appearance, stacking space, and required track length. Product drawings should state both inches and millimeters.
An 88.9 mm PVC slat offers a practical balance between privacy and daylight. When the slats overlap correctly, they reduce direct glare while allowing soft light through the room. Rotating them slightly can brighten a workspace without fully exposing the window. PVC also resists moisture, making it useful near kitchens, bathrooms, and humid coastal interiors. It still needs proper support.
Weight depends on more than width. Slat thickness, PVC density, surface texture, and total drop all matter. A longer blind can place noticeable stress on the carrier system. I recommend checking the weight per square meter before selecting a headrail. Measure twice.
From installation experience, uneven overlaps often cause unwanted light gaps. Small errors in cutting or spacing can become obvious at sunrise. A reliable specification should include slat width, thickness, overlap, total weight, light-control rating, and fire-performance information where required. The phrase “5-inch PVC blind” can be used loosely in some markets, which creates confusion. Buyers should request a physical sample and confirm the actual width before approving production.
For global buyers, 3.5-inch PVC vertical blinds should be evaluated against recognized safety benchmarks, not appearance alone. ANSI/WCMA A100.1 focuses on window-covering safety, especially hazardous operating cords and accessible loops. EN 13120 addresses internal blinds, including construction, operation, and safety performance. Requirements may differ by market.
A reliable supplier should provide recent test reports, product specifications, and traceable production records. Check the headrail, tilt mechanism, wand length, cord routing, and mounting strength. PVC slats should also be checked for cracking, sharp edges, odor, and dimensional stability after heat exposure. A compliant-looking sample is not enough. I have seen attractive samples fail during repeated operation testing.
Tips: Ask whether testing covered the exact 3.5-inch model, not a similar series. Confirm the applicable standard edition and testing laboratory. Request installation instructions in the destination language. Inspect packaging for warning labels and secure hardware. Also verify local fire, chemical, and consumer-safety rules, because ANSI/WCMA A100.1 and EN 13120 are benchmarks, not universal market approval. A small documentation gap can delay an entire shipment.

For global buyers, the seven best 3.5-inch PVC vertical blinds are not chosen by appearance alone. Energy performance matters more in rooms facing strong sunlight. A low U-factor means better resistance to heat transfer through the blind system. However, U-factor values may vary with glazing, airflow, and installation quality. Check the test method before comparing suppliers.
SHGC measures how much solar energy enters through the window. A lower SHGC usually helps reduce cooling demand in hot climates. Solar heat reduction is easier to understand: it shows how much sunlight the blind blocks. Dark PVC slats may absorb more heat, while lighter surfaces often reflect more radiation. Keep it practical.
In field checks, I would inspect closed slats at midday and measure indoor surface temperature. A small gap can weaken real performance. This is often overlooked. Ask for laboratory data, product tolerances, and installation instructions in the destination market. Thermal comfort also depends on window orientation, curtain-wall design, and local weather. No single metric tells the whole story. A blind with excellent laboratory results may perform poorly when slats do not overlap evenly or controls remain partly open. That is where careful review matters.
For global buyers, the seven best 3.5-inch PVC vertical blinds are not judged by appearance alone. Check slat width, material thickness, rotation quality, headrail strength, light control, cleaning ease, and replacement-part access. Measure the window recess, finished width, height, and available mounting depth. A small error can leave visible gaps.
Request installation drawings before ordering. Confirm whether the blind supports inside or outside mounting, and identify the required screws for concrete, timber, or drywall. Test the carrier movement by hand; it should glide without grinding. Safety needs equal attention. Choose designs with protected operating systems, secured chains, and no accessible loops near children. Local safety rules may differ, so ask for current test reports rather than relying on a sales statement.
Import paperwork also deserves careful review. Confirm the correct tariff classification with a customs professional, because PVC products may be classified differently by destination. Prepare a commercial invoice, packing list, product dimensions, country-of-origin details, and any required material or chemical compliance documents. Packaging should protect slat edges from crushing during long-distance transport. I have seen perfect samples arrive with bent headrails after weak carton testing. That mistake is avoidable, but not always predictable. Compare shipping volume, minimum order quantity, lead time, inspection options, and spare-part policy before payment. Leave room for local installation practices. They can challenge your original assumptions.
